AgriFinance Hub: Smart Fintech for Farmers

A vertical SaaS platform called "AgriFinance Hub" designed specifically for farmers and agricultural businesses that streamlines access to tailored financial services, including crop insurance, equipment loans, and government grants. By leveraging real-time data on weather patterns, soil health, and market trends, the platform offers predictive analytics that helps users optimize their financial decisions and mitigate risks. What makes AgriFinance Hub unique is its integration of blockchain technology for transparent transaction histories and smart contracts, ensuring secure and efficient financial dealings within the agricultural sector.

Competition Analysis

Score: 65/100

While there are several fintech solutions, few cater exclusively to agriculture with integrated blockchain for transparency. Competitors include FarmDrive and Agrilyst, who focus on financial access and farm analytics respectively.

FarmDrive

Provides credit scoring for smallholder farmers.

Strengths: Established in emerging markets

Weaknesses: Limited blockchain integration

Agrilyst

Farm management platform with data analytics.

Strengths: Comprehensive farm data

Weaknesses: Focuses more on management than finance
